Samsung On A High, As Judge Rejects Apple’s Plea To Ban Samsung Phones
Advertisement
The lawsuit that began in 2011 in US, which was imposed by Apple on Samsung refraining the latter from selling 23 models in the country has ended badly for Apple Inc. Reports suggest that The Judge Lucy Koh said Apple has not been able to provide substantial evidence to prove that the Korean smartphone maker has infringed Apple’s patents.
Some of the devices that came under the scanner due to the feud was Samsung Galaxy S2 and Tab 10. These devices have already become outdated and in most parts of the world are not being sold. The verdict came in favour of Samsung and another chapter for the patent war has come to an end.
Samsung has moved on to better and feature rich models of the Galaxy phones such as S4 and S5.
